Outward Bound Canada’s Veterans’ Program is designed to help Canadian Armed Forces veterans face the challenges they often encounter post-deployment, through inspiring journeys of healing and self-discovery in the Canadian wilderness.
Many military men and women struggle with lingering physical and mental impacts of their experiences, including depression, anxiety, isolation, family difficulties, and, in general, with the challenges that often accompany reintegration into civilian life.
Our specially designed programs take veterans on week-long expeditions, incorporating activities such as rock-climbing, ski mountaineering, sea-kayaking and hiking. Participants are given an opportunity to reflect on and share their experiences and transition challenges in a supportive and restorative environment.
